Our new website launched in January and what do I notice? The email sign up is below the fold! Now, don’t get me wrong, it’s a groovy sign-up including an awesome comment box. And yes, there is a
call-out above the fold in a prominent place that drops the user down to the sign-up box. But since email is my personal favorite, I was concerned that this setup wouldn’t produce the number of sign-ups we were hoping for.
Like all good creative companies, we had to battle this one out a bit before finally settling on an A/B test using a modal window for half the traffic, while keeping the original set-up for the other half.
You might ask what a modal window is? I did. And it’s best explained with a picture so here ‘tis…
We ran the test for 2 weeks and the results were surprising:
You guessed it, we ditched the modal window option. We’re smart like that… and we’re glad we tested it too.
